I want to upgrade my audio - best path
I have 2009 E89 and the sound doesn't get very loud, especially with the top down. Can I just replace the head unit and line up the wiring, or is there more to it? What do I lose if I replace the head unit (e.g., the ability to program the car or some units)?
VIN Decode S645 BMW US Radio S663 Radio BMW Professional S693 Preparation BMW satellite radio S697 Area-Code 1 for DVD S6FL USB/audio interface S639 Preparation f mobile phone cpl. USA/CDN In the trunk there are two boxes on the left hand side (TCU 1.5 MOST GSM and I assume the phone bluetooth unit). There are no boxes on the right hand side where an amp normally goes. I don't pay for BMW assist or anything like that. I've searched and BMW has so many combinations that the answer are not very straight forward. Thanks for your help! |

If you don’t have 676 or 677 in your vin then you don’t have an off board DSP/amp and rely on the onboard amp in the head unit..
There are many options Simple one is to add an off board amp maybe with DSP and uprate the speakers ..the speakers even in the 677 system are pretty cheap n nasty ..so yours will be really not much good…IMHO. I think there are now replacement head units that will fit the facade but I’ve no experience of those….

I did the full upgrade using Audiotec-Fisher - Sounds awesome now. Also added CarPlay
Amplifier: https://www.audiotec-fischer.de/en/m...fiers/up-10dsp Speakers: https://www.audiotec-fischer.de/en/m...number=M122432 Woofers: https://www.audiotec-fischer.de/en/m...number=M130802 For the CarPlay module i went with a company called ZZ2 that designs vehicle specific CarPlay adaptors. The module is placed in behind the OEM infotainment and wired inline with that system via a factory T-harness. This means that all your existing BMW systems will continue to work and you will also have the Wireless Apple CarPlay that you can switch back and forth freely between the two. |

You can adjust the head parameter to ‘hi fi’ which then sets it flat so yiu can use your new DSP / amp equalisation..
As DavesZed suggested there are a few options depending on budget to add an off board amp..the one David suggested goes behind the dash trim.. I’m aware of two suppliers at least doing integrated systems for the base unit If you just keep with the 6 speakers than no re routing required…decent woofers plus good mid range units should transform listening and cope with much higher power ..

I have read the S663 Professional only outputs 12watts per channel into 4ohms at 1% distortion. There seems to be a lot of published mis-information about the US configurations as even Bimmer-Tech.net says the base stereo in the US has woofers under the seats in addition to the mids in the doors and in the rear corners. No underseat speakers in my car. So, I’ll be replacing the existing speakers, adding the component speakers with tweeters in the doors, add a speaker in the middle dash location and between the seats, and the same Alpine speakers in the rear corners. A powered compact sub will go behind the passenger seat. That’s my plan, and will document the install in a new thread here and on my YouTube channel.

As for the non-iDrive headunit, there is an upgrade to the later version that looks identical (they all do from the outside) that has built-in Bluetooth (calls only) and USB control. This can be identified by the Bluetooth symbol on the label as well as the word "Combox" and also has the extra white socket on the rear (USB input). As well as these extra features it also came with a much better internal amplifier, producing much better sound than the 'strangled' original base version. Not many people talk about the better amplification of this unit but it's definitely there as I did this as my very first mod on my own E89 and was very, happily, surprised by it.
